Top Tips for Buying a Holiday Home

What better way to escape from all the stresses of daily life than to take a relaxing break in beautiful surroundings with all your home comforts at your fingertips? Static caravan holidays are the ideal home away from home if you like to holiday in the UK and want to have a dedicated place to visit to without the hassle of searching for accommodation, making enquiries and filing in booking forms. If you’re looking to purchase a static caravan for the first time then you need to consider a number of factors...

The location of the holiday park

Most people will want to take short breaks in their static caravan throughout the year so you need to consider how far you’re willing to travel to enjoy a short break. If the caravan park is a long drive away then you may not want to make such a long journey for a weekend break so you might not be able to make the most out of your accommodation. You should also consider what attractions the area has to offer so that you know there’ll be plenty to keep you entertained even if you make regular visits to the caravan park.

The facilities in the holiday park

Certain parks tend to be aimed at certain types of holidaymakers such family focused parks with children’s clubs, swimming pools and fast food restaurants. If this doesn’t sound like your idea of a good time then make sure you look into quieter parks which have the facilities and atmosphere more suited to people who enjoy a peaceful and relaxing break.

The upkeep and cost of a static caravan

As with every large purchase you need to shop around to get the best deal for your static caravan. As well as the initial cost of the caravan, you also need to factor in the cost of the plot and running expenses. The cost of your plot will be the largest outlay which will be an annual charge but you also need to budget for insurance, gas and electricity.

Static caravan holidays are the perfect solution if you love taking short breaks in the UK so make sure you consider the above factors before deciding where to buy a static caravan.
